1. Cleanse Twice Daily with a Gentle Cleanser
Cleansing is the cornerstone of any skincare routine for oily skin. Wash your face twice daily—morning and night—with a gentle, oil-free cleanser containing salicylic acid or tea tree oil to remove excess oil and impurities. Avoid harsh soaps that strip your skin, as they can trigger more oil production. Try a foaming cleanser like CeraVe Foaming Cleanser, which is gentle yet effective. 2. Use a Lightweight Moisturizer
Think oily skin doesn’t need hydration? That’s a common myth! Skipping moisturizer can dehydrate your skin, causing it to produce even more oil to compensate. Opt for a lightweight, non-comedogenic moisturizer with ingredients like hyaluronic acid or glycerin to hydrate without clogging pores. We love gel-based options like Neutrogena Hydro Boost for a mattifying effect in your oily skin care routine. Apply a small amount after cleansing to keep your skin balanced and smooth.
3. Exfoliate Weekly to Unclog Pores
Exfoliation is key to preventing clogged pores, a common issue for oily skin types. Use a chemical exfoliant with salicylic acid or glycolic acid 1–2 times a week to gently remove dead skin cells and reduce acne. Avoid physical scrubs, which can irritate and inflame your skin. 5. Incorporate a Clay Mask Weekly

Clay masks are your secret weapon for oily skin. Masks with kaolin or bentonite clay absorb excess oil, detoxify pores, and leave your skin refreshed. Use a mask like Aztec Secret Indian Healing Clay once a week after cleansing for a deep clean. Mix with apple cider vinegar for added benefits. 6. Use Oil-Free Sunscreen Daily
Sunscreen is a must, even for oily skin, to protect against UV damage and premature aging. Choose a broad-spectrum, oil-free SPF 30+ with a matte or gel finish, like La Roche-Posay Anthelios Clear Skin SPF 60. 8. Avoid Touching Your Face
Your hands carry oils, dirt, and bacteria that can clog pores and worsen breakouts. Avoid touching your face throughout the day, and clean your phone screen regularly to prevent oil transfer during calls. If you wear glasses, sanitize the nose pads to keep your skin clear. This simple habit can make a big difference in managing oily skin.

10. Consult a Dermatologist for Persistent Issues
If oiliness or acne persists despite a solid routine, a dermatologist can offer tailored solutions, such as retinoids or professional treatments.
